Barista Irina Baghdasaryan makes cappuccinos with a great deal of heart at the Belmont Center’s Starbucks on Leonard Street.
Photo of the Day: Cappuccino Done Right

Barista Irina Baghdasaryan makes cappuccinos with a great deal of heart at the Belmont Center’s Starbucks on Leonard Street.
Leave a Review or Comment